1. Price


The expense to soft clean a home is typically more than that of stress washing, yet it is essential to think about all the elements included. The square video footage of the home plays a significant duty in just how much it costs to clean it, as does the variety of tales.

A specialist soft wash business is able to utilize unique devices that drops the water stress and broadens the water flow, providing it a softer discuss surface areas like cedar or asphalt shingles that can obtain damaged by the high-pressure of a typical stress washing machine. This approach additionally utilizes environment-friendly cleaning services that help eliminate dirt, mold, mold and various other pathogens while minimizing damages to the surface of your home.

These cleaning products are created to kill bacteria and microorganisms at the molecular level, leading to a longer-lasting clean for your outside surfaces. Additionally, they help reduce sun direct exposure for your home's paint, expanding its life and decreasing the chance of fading and cracking gradually.

2. Environment


Pressure washing is a fast and reliable method to tidy many different types of surfaces. Yet mouse click the next web page of water that power washers provide leave an environmental impact that needs to be thought about.

A standard cleaning session can consume numerous gallons of water per minute. That's a lot of water, particularly in areas that already encounter decreasing water sources. And also, cleaning remedies that are utilized during some pressure cleaning work contain chemicals that, when washed into local waterways, can hurt aquatic life and disrupt the balance of ecosystems.

Soft washing, on the other hand, integrates secure water stress with biodegradable sterilizing cleansers to remove mold, microorganisms, algae, fungus, mold and mildew and moss from outside surfaces. Specialist soft washing groups make use of the correct concentrations of these chemicals to prevent damages to landscape design and other exterior features around a home or company. This conservation aspect helps surfaces last longer, decreasing the requirement for early replacement and the subsequent environmental influence of manufacturing new materials.

3. Security


If dust, mold, mold and mildew, and other natural accumulations are permitted to expand on your home's surfaces, they can produce a friendly breeding ground for microorganisms and vermin. Stress cleaning can additionally reduce the quantity of plant pollen on your residential property, which will certainly benefit anyone that deals with seasonal allergies.

Nonetheless, the high-powered water that is launched with a pressure washing machine can create injuries if it is available in contact with somebody or if it's mistakenly focused on them. If you're mosting likely to press wash your home, it is very important to hire skilled professionals who recognize the proper way to do so safely.



Soft washing is a safe choice to pressure cleaning since it does not create the same degree of water stress. However, it may take longer and call for repeat applications to obtain your surface areas completely clean. It's likewise not as efficient at eliminating difficult stains from specific kinds of products like roofing systems or wood exterior siding. Recognizing the advantages of both techniques will help you determine which is finest for your home.
